AuthBridge Partners with Redacto to Solve Consent Governance for India’s DPDP Era

The partnership bridges the gap between identity, consent, and data usage – enabling enterprises to operationalise DPDP compliance at scale.

NEW DELHI, April 16,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— AuthBridge, India’s leading provider of digital trust and identity verification solutions, today announced a strategic partnership with Redacto, a privacy-first technology company specialising in data redaction and consent governance. The partnership aims to help Indian enterprises operationalise consent management and strengthen compliance with the Digital Personal Data Protection (DPDP) Act.

Through this partnership, AuthBridge and Redacto will combine identity intelligence with real-time consent governance and automated data redaction capabilities to help organisations embed consent across the entire data lifecycle from onboarding and identity verification to data access, processing, and sharing. The collaboration addresses a critical gap emerging in India’s consent-led digital economy, where organisations have advanced in data collection and identity verification but continue to face challenges in governing how personal data is used with valid consent, clear purpose limitation, and auditability, exposing enterprises to compliance and operational risks.

Responding to the partnership, Mr Amit Kumar, CEO, Redacto, said, “India has solved the identity layer — AuthBridge has made verification seamless. What hasn’t been solved is what happens after. Once you know who someone is, do you have consent to use their data? For how long? For what purpose? Can you prove it under audit? The DPDP Act makes these questions non-negotiable. This partnership connects the identity layer to the consent layer for the first time — turning verification from a one-time event into the starting point of governed, accountable data use.”
